F&F DMA-1 Single-Phase Digital Ammeter 0-20A Modular
The F&F DMA-1 is a high-precision single-phase digital ammeter engineered for direct current measurement within the 0-20A range. Designed for seamless integration into electrical distribution boards, this device features a compact modular housing suitable for standard DIN rail mounting. It provides reliable, real-time monitoring of electrical current, making it an essential component for maintaining safety and efficiency in both residential and industrial power systems.
The primary benefit of the F&F DMA-1 is its ability to deliver accurate, real-time current readings, allowing users to monitor power consumption and detect potential electrical issues immediately. Its modular design simplifies the installation process, as it fits perfectly onto standard DIN rails alongside other protective equipment. The digital display ensures clear readability, eliminating the inaccuracies often associated with traditional analog gauges. Furthermore, the robust construction ensures long-term operational stability in various environmental conditions.
This device is not suitable for measuring currents exceeding 20A, as direct connection to higher loads may cause damage to the internal circuitry. It is also not intended for use in high-voltage industrial systems beyond the specified single-phase parameters or in environments with extreme moisture or corrosive gases that could compromise the digital display.
To use the F&F DMA-1, ensure the power supply is disconnected before installation. Mount the device onto a standard DIN rail within your distribution board. Connect the phase conductor in series with the ammeter terminals according to the provided wiring diagram. Once securely installed and verified, restore power to the circuit. The digital display will automatically activate and begin showing the current flow in real-time.
For optimal performance and safety, ensure all electrical connections are tightened to the manufacturer's specifications and that the device is installed by a qualified electrician in accordance with local electrical regulations.
